Tone Your Legs and Gluteus With Treadmills Incline

When you climb the slope of a treadmill, your body needs to work harder to withstand the added pressure. This results in more calories being burned, as well as strengthening the glutes and legs. It also improves the cardiovascular health.

Almost all treadmills have an inclined feature that you can alter to increase the intensity of your workout. But, you may be wondering if treadmills incline can actually benefit your exercise routine.

Increased Calories Boiled

Using treadmills incline can increase the intensity of your exercises and help you achieve your fitness goals quicker. Using a variety of incline levels during your workouts can also test different muscles and keep your exercise routines exciting.

Running or walking on a slope can increase the muscles that are activated in your legs, particularly the quads, hamstrings and glutes. This is a great way to increase lower body strength and toning, without the risk of impacting joints. Running and walking at an angle will also burn more calories than flat exercises, due to the increased metabolic rate that comes with exercising at an incline.

Incline treadmills can be particularly helpful for runners. They can help runners improve their endurance and reduce knee pain while improving their cardiorespiratory fitness and burning calories. The reason is that incline treadmills allow runners run at a faster pace without risking injury. Incline treadmills permit runners to climb hills, which requires more effort. This improves their endurance and burning calories.

Increased Tone of Muscle Tone

On a treadmill with incline of 12 that has an inclined slope, you will utilize different muscles than the ones used on flat surfaces. You'll have to use your quadriceps and glutes in order to push yourself uphill. The extra effort will test your hamstrings as well as the muscles in your back. These additional muscle groups aren't just going to increase the amount of calories burned during your workout but will also help tone the muscles they are working to keep a good posture and form while you move.

So, even those that may not be able to run outside because of an injury may still benefit from the incline feature on their treadmill. Inclining training on a treadmill can help you increase your endurance for cardio while reducing the stress on your hips and knees. Walking on an incline will strengthen the muscles in your legs, and improve your balance and coordination.

It's essential to start slowly if you're new at the incline exercise. Many experts suggest starting with a low incline, approximately 1 or 2 percent and gradually increasing it. This will enable you to better replicate the slight elevation changes you would experience outdoors and give you a better idea of how to change the incline on a treadmill your muscles react to this type workout.

You can burn more calories by adding an incline when you're on the treadmill. It also will test the muscles in your legs and buttocks. Be careful not to climb too steep of an incline because it could cause you to hold onto the handrails for support which reduces the activation of your leg muscles.

livspo-folding-treadmill-for-home-use-2-Reducing the impact on joints

Running and jogging put lots of stress on your knees. Utilizing a treadmill's incline feature to simulate walking uphill, however, minimizes the strain on your joints and can still provide an intense exercise. A slight increase of between 1 and 3 percent will level the surface under your feet and shift the load away from your knees and onto your glutes. This decreases knee strain and provides an exercise that is low-impact for people with joint pain or who are recovering from injuries.

A treadmill with an inclined slope increases the intensity of your workout and makes you feel like you are running outdoors. If you're training for a marathon or cross-country race, experimenting with different treadmill incline settings can help you prepare for the natural terrain and the varying inclines you will encounter when you actually run outdoors.

Another benefit of walking on treadmills with an incline is that it can protect joints by reducing or even preventing knee osteoarthritis (OA). Walking on incline, for example, helps prevent the breakdown of cartilage and other supportive tissues in the knee. This is because the incline position of walking prevents your knees from hitting the ground with force.

If you're new to treadmill walking on an incline or have knee issues, start by doing a short warm-up on the flat treadmill surface prior to starting your incline workout. Begin by walking on a low incline, such as 2-3%, and then gradually increase the incline in small increments until you get accustomed to the exercise. This will reduce the risk of injury, for example shin splints and make your treadmill workout more efficient.

Improved Heart Health

The incline on your treadmill will increase the load for your lungs and heart. Your body will work harder to draw in more oxygen, and over time this can help reduce your blood pressure. The increased demands on your cardiovascular system due to training on incline increases your endurance and make it easier to maintain your target heart rates.

You might want to start by working at a lower angle and gradually increase it over time, based on your fitness level and health goals. This will allow you the opportunity to develop your muscle strength and endurance and practice good form before moving up to higher levels of an incline. In addition, you'll be able monitor your results more closely as you slowly begin to notice and feel the physical results of your hard exercise.

Increased Interval Training

The incline treadmill argos feature of treadmills makes it a great tool for interval training. The ability to alternate periods of higher incline with flat or lower incline segments increase the intensity and tests the body in a manner that can be safely done at home. Begin by warming up on flat or slightly inclined surfaces. Then gradually increase the incline as your client is accustomed to it.

A slight slope makes walking or jogging feel like running uphill, but with less joint stress and less risk of injury. The addition of an incline will aid in building endurance and improve their cardiovascular fitness and overall health, while helping to tone the major muscles in the legs and buttocks.

For instance, let your client start their workout with a quick walk at a moderate pace on the treadmill and then gradually increase the incline. After a short period of walking at an increased incline pace, ask them to return to the moderate pace for a few more minutes to allow their body to recover. Repeat the incline-moderate pace pattern for a few more times.

This type of workout can help boost VO2 max, which is a measure of the highest amount of oxygen that your body can utilize during exercise. It can also lessen stress on the ankles, knees and hips when compared to running on a flat ground.
